"Vinegar Oil Cruet XVIII In Earthenware And Cut Glass"
Superb and very rare vinegar cruet in openwork white earthenware decorated with lily flowers. Two cut glass cruets. Set sold in found condition, earthenware with shocks, a split burette (it is the handle that holds everything in place), impurities in the glass. Period early eighteenth century.
